f2fs: allocate node blocks for atomic write block replacement
When a node block is missing for atomic write block replacement, we need to allocate it in advance of the replacement. Signed-off-by: Daeho Jeong <daehojeong@google.com> Reviewed-by: Chao Yu <chao@kernel.org> Signed-off-by: Jaegeuk Kim <jaegeuk@kernel.org>
